The Symbolism Behind Hair Cutting Dreams
One of the most common interpretations of dreams about cutting hair is related to a desire for change or transformation. Hair is often associated with personal identity and self-image, so cutting it in a dream might signify a need to let go of the past or make a fresh start. This could be related to a major life event, a new beginning, or a wish to break free from outdated beliefs or habits.
Alternatively, cutting hair in dreams can also symbolize a loss of power or control. This could represent feelings of vulnerability, insecurity, or a fear of losing something important. It may indicate a need to assert oneself or take charge of a situation in waking life.
Another interpretation of hair cutting dreams is connected to self-expression. Hair is often seen as a form of personal expression or creativity, so cutting it in a dream might suggest a desire to explore new ways of expressing oneself or releasing pent-up emotions.
Furthermore, the act of cutting hair in dreams can have different meanings depending on the context. For example, cutting someone else’s hair might symbolize a desire to influence or control that person in some way. On the other hand, having someone else cut your hair could signify feelings of dependence or a need for guidance.
In some cases, dreams about cutting hair can also be a reflection of external influences or societal expectations. For instance, if cutting hair is traditionally seen as a sign of mourning or repentance in a particular culture, dreaming about it might be a manifestation of societal norms or values.
Overall, dreams about cutting hair are complex and multifaceted, with symbolism that can vary based on individual experiences and emotions. By paying attention to the specific details and emotions in the dream, it’s possible to gain deeper insight into what cutting hair might represent in the dreamer’s waking life.
Variations of Hair Cutting Dreams and Their Interpretations
When it comes to dreams about cutting your hair, the context and details of the dream play a significant role in deciphering its meaning. Here are some common variations of hair cutting dreams and their interpretations:
1. Cutting Someone Else’s Hair
Dreaming about cutting someone else’s hair may symbolize a desire to take control or influence someone else’s life. It could also represent feelings of power, dominance, or a need to assert yourself in a particular relationship or situation.
2. Cutting Your Own Hair Short
Cutting your own hair short in a dream could symbolize a desire for change or transformation. It may indicate a readiness to let go of the past and embrace a new chapter in your life. Alternatively, it could suggest a need to break free from old habits or beliefs that no longer serve you.
3. Uneven Haircut
Dreaming about getting an uneven haircut may reflect feelings of insecurity or dissatisfaction with your appearance. It could signify a lack of balance or harmony in your life, leading to feelings of vulnerability or uncertainty. This dream could also indicate a fear of judgment or criticism from others.
4. Shaved Head
A dream about shaving your head or having a shaved head can symbolize a desire for a fresh start or a sense of liberation. It may signify a willingness to let go of societal expectations or conventional norms. This dream could also represent a need for authenticity and self-expression.
5. Hair Falling Out
Experiencing hair falling out in a dream may indicate feelings of loss, stress, or a sense of vulnerability. It could symbolize a fear of aging, illness, or a lack of control in certain aspects of your life. This dream may also suggest a need to nurture yourself and prioritize self-care.

Hair and Dreams: Cultural Perspectives
Interpreting dreams about cutting hair can differ based on cultural beliefs and practices. In many cultures, hair holds significant symbolism and cutting it in a dream can have various meanings.
Western Culture
In Western culture, hair is often associated with beauty, femininity, and identity. Dreams about cutting one’s hair can sometimes reflect a desire for change or a need to let go of the past. It may also signify a sense of empowerment or a desire to take control of one’s life.
Asian Culture
In Asian cultures, particularly in countries like China and Japan, hair symbolizes strength, wisdom, and status. Dreaming of cutting one’s hair can be seen as a warning of upcoming hardships or a need to make sacrifices for the greater good. In some cases, it can also represent a need to let go of vanity and embrace humility.
African Culture
In many African cultures, hair is a sacred symbol of one’s ancestry, heritage, and spiritual connection. Dreams about cutting hair can signify a loss of power, a break in one’s connection to their roots, or a need for purification and renewal. It may also symbolize a desire to break free from societal norms and expectations.
Indigenous Cultures
In Indigenous cultures around the world, hair holds deep spiritual significance and is often believed to be a source of energy and intuition. Dreams of cutting hair can represent a disconnect from one’s intuition or a need to release negative energy. It may also symbolize a spiritual awakening or a call to reconnect with one’s ancestors and traditions.
